The IOTC Purse seine ROS reporting workshop is aimed at strengthening national capacities for the collection, validation, and timely reporting of purse seine fisheries data. The workshop will focus on improving the quality, accuracy, and consistency of data related to the use of Fish Aggregating Devices (DFOBs), as well as on enhancing the implementation of the Regional Observer Scheme (ROS) with emphasis on the use of the updated reporting forms, data harmonization, and verification of operational and catch information. Through practical sessions and the exchange of experiences among participating countries, the workshop seeks to promote best practices, increase transparency, and support more effective compliance with IOTC reporting requirements.
